Long-term renal function in patients with chronic kidney disease following radical cystectomy and orthotopic neobladder

Hamed Ahmadi et al.

Summary: This study compared the long-term renal function of CKD Ilia patients who underwent RC/ONB surgery with a control group. The results showed that patients with lower preoperative GFR who underwent RC/ONB surgery had comparable renal function to those with GFR≥60 mL/min/1.73 m(2). Multivariate analysis identified neoadjuvant chemotherapy as the strongest predictor of GFR decline.

Outcomes of patients undergoing concurrent radical cystectomy and nephroureterectomy: A single-institution series

Gianpaolo P. Carpinito et al.

Summary: Combined radical cystectomy and radical nephroureterectomy is not commonly performed in urological oncology, but it is a feasible option for select patients. This retrospective study analyzed the data of 27 patients and found that concurrent RC+RNU carries an elevated perioperative risk, particularly in highly comorbid patients, and there is a high incidence of occult upper tract urothelial carcinoma in non-functional kidney patients.

Timing, Patterns and Predictors of 90-Day Readmission Rate after Robotic Radical Cystectomy

Giovanni E. Cacciamani et al.

Summary: The study examined the 90-day readmission after robotic radical cystectomy and found a significant rate of readmission. In-hospital infections and male gender were identified as independent factors for readmission, with most readmissions occurring within the first 2 weeks post-discharge, mainly due to metabolic derangements and infections.

Fluid Management During Kidney Transplantation: A Consensus Statement of the Committee on Transplant Anesthesia of the American Society of Anesthesiologists

Gebhard Wagener et al.

Summary: Review of current literature suggests that starch solutions should be avoided in kidney transplantation and there is no evidence supporting routine use of albumin solutions. Balanced crystalloid solutions such as Lactated Ringer may be more suitable for kidney transplants. Central venous pressure as a tool to assess fluid status is weakly supported.
